响应式个人主页:CSS3动画与HTML5摄影相册设计

需积分: 0 0 下载量 35 浏览量 更新于2024-10-31 收藏 4.12MB RAR 举报
资源摘要信息: "简单动画css3动画个人博客blog仿flash响应式ajax响应式个人主页lightbox摄影图片相册迷你html5" 在这个资源摘要中,我们可以看到几个重要的知识点和组件。首先,资源的标题表明它是一个关于个人博客的设计,其中包括了CSS3动画来模仿旧式的Flash动画效果,这是一种现代网页设计中流行的复古风格。同时,这个博客是响应式的,意味着它能够适应不同大小的屏幕,无论是手机、平板还是桌面电脑。此外,该资源还使用了Ajax技术,这通常意味着内容可以无需重新加载整个页面即可动态更新。 接下来,我们将详细探讨标题中提到的各个技术和组件。 CSS3动画: CSS3是CSS规范的最新版本,它引入了许多强大的功能,其中包括动画效果。CSS3动画允许开发者使用CSS规则来创建流畅的动画效果,而不需要依赖JavaScript或Flash。这些动画可以应用于各种元素,比如颜色变换、大小缩放、位置移动等,使得网页能够以更为吸引人的方式呈现信息。 响应式设计: 响应式设计是一种网站设计方法论,目的是使网站能够适应不同设备的屏幕尺寸和分辨率。这通常通过使用百分比宽度、流式布局、媒体查询、灵活的图像和媒体等技术来实现。响应式设计确保了用户体验的一致性,无论用户是通过手机、平板还是桌面设备访问网站。 Ajax: Ajax(Asynchronous JavaScript and XML)是一种创建交互式网页应用的网页开发技术。它允许网页在不重新加载整个页面的情况下,与服务器交换数据并更新部分网页内容。这种技术为用户提供了更快的响应时间和更流畅的用户体验。 HTML5: HTML5是HTML的最新版本,它为网页添加了许多新的元素和属性。HTML5包括了对多媒体内容(如音频、视频)的原生支持,以及对离线存储、绘图API等更先进的技术的支持。在标题中提到的“迷你HTML5”,可能指的是这个资源中包含了精简的、高效实现的HTML5元素和特性。 bootstrap.min.css: 这是Bootstrap框架的压缩版本的CSS样式表。Bootstrap是一个流行的开源前端框架,它提供了一套预先设计好的样式和组件,使得开发者能够快速开发出美观且响应式的网页。 font-awesome.min.css: 这是一个字体图标库,提供了大量的矢量图标,可以直接通过CSS类使用,而不需要额外的图片文件。这些图标在网页设计中非常实用,因为它们可以轻松地缩放和修改颜色而不失真。 hero-slider-style.css和templatemo-style.css: 这两个文件可能是针对特定部分(如幻灯片、模板样式)定制的CSS文件,用于调整和优化布局、颜色方案和动画等。 magnific-popup.css: 这可能是用于创建弹出层或者模态窗口的样式文件,通常用于图片相册、视频、表单和其他内容的展示。 fontawesome-webfont.eot: 这是一个字体文件,通常与Font Awesome图标库一起使用。EOT文件格式是微软开发的一种字体文件格式,用于在Internet Explorer浏览器中显示Web字体。 index.html: 这是项目的主要HTML文件,是网站结构和内容的入口点。 bg-05.jpg、bg-02.jpg、bg-01.jpg: 这些是作为背景使用的图片文件,可能用于网页的不同部分,如网站的头部、幻灯片区域等,来增加视觉效果。 综上所述,这个资源可能是一个综合了现代网页设计技术的个人博客模板,包括了响应式布局、CSS3动画、Ajax技术和精简的HTML5代码,以及各种CSS样式表和资源文件。这样的设计能够让个人博客在各种设备上都提供流畅和一致的用户体验,同时提供了足够的自定义空间以适应不同的内容和设计需求。